目的:观察辨证论治对早期邪毒壅盛证、气虚证H22荷瘤小鼠的疗效。方法:将雄性昆明种小鼠随机分组,除正常组外,腋下接种H22腹水癌细胞,出瘤后,做四诊检测并辨证,按照一定标准从160只荷瘤小鼠中挑选出单纯邪毒壅盛小鼠36只、气虚证小鼠30只,将2组小鼠分别分为对照组、成方组、辨证组,成方组予固定成方,辨证组予邪毒方或益气方,综合比较药物对各组疾病与证候的疗效。结果:辨证论治在延长小鼠带瘤生存时间和抑制肿瘤生长方面的优势不突出,但具有显著地保护荷瘤小鼠阳气的作用,有助于减缓邪毒壅盛荷瘤小鼠阴虚的发生发展。结论:辨证论治对于提高早期邪毒壅盛证、气虚证荷瘤小鼠的生存质量有益。
目的:观察辨证论治对H22荷瘤小鼠的生存质量、生存期的影响。方法:将雄性昆明种小鼠随机分组,除正常对照组外,腋下接种H22瘤株,出瘤后,分层随机分为模型组、非辨证治疗组(以下简称非辨组)、辨证治疗组(以下简称辨证组)。采用小鼠四诊标准化、计量化采集方法,收集相关诊断指标,进行辨证,非辨组给予固定方治疗,辨证组根据具体证型给予相应的辨证论治。综合评估其生存质量及生存期限。结果:用药组生存期均长于模型组;辨证组各项四诊指标和证候的严重程度优于非辨组、模型组。结论:荷瘤小鼠是可以实现个体化辨证论治的,经辨证论治对其生存质量及生存期均有帮助。
建立动物模型是医学研究的重要手段,而中医对于疾病的发病、诊断、治疗等一直多以人为观察对象。本文旨在总结中医证候动物模型的研究进展,为继续进行中医证候实验研究提供思路与借鉴,建议今后的中医动物实验研究,侧重以下方面:建立中医证候动物模型的非创伤性辨证论治体系、包括相应的辨证标准;利用分子生物学的快速进展,从基因、蛋白质等微观层次研究中医证本质;开展遗传性病证动物的研究等。
Objective:To describe the occurrence and evolution of the syndromes of three hypertensive rat models,as well as the relationship between diseases and syndromes.Methods: Three hypertensive rat models were established,including spontaneously hypertensive rat,DOCA-salt hypertensive rat,and renovascular hypertensive rat.Then the standardization and quantitization method of diagnosis and differentiation were applied to examine and appraise the above models in an objective,dynamic and quantified way.Results: ①The blood pressure of three models rose to different extent.Spontaneously hypertensive rats showed typical syndrome of Yin-deficiency due to hyperactivity of Yang which aggravated gradually.After the operation,after syndrome of deficiency of Qi emerged in earlier stage,the DOCA-salt model rats had the tendency of preponderance of Yang and Qi.There was no conspicuous Yin-Yang excess or deficiency in renovascular hypertensive rats.The sham operated group had Qi and blood damaged and did not completely recover until the end of the experiment.② Different syndromes appeared in different patients with the same disease,or appeared on different stages of a patient.③ Similar syndromes appeared on the same stage of different diseases,or appeared on different stages of different diseases.Conclusion: There exist different syndromes in different hypertensive rat models.The phenomena of "same disease but different syndromes" and phenomenon of same syndrome but different diseases" provide the evidence for the clinic practice and therapeutic effect evaluation.
Objective To investigate the symptom and signs about tumor-bearing mice with its development. Method Apply four diagnostic methods workstation and standard to detect tumor radialis,weight and armpit temperature,use magnified digital photos to acquire r value about paws and tails, calculate level and vertical movement,estimate the tumor volume and weight removing tumor.According to this,we established syndrome differentiation standard about phlegm stagnation and exuberance of evils,yin-deficiency, qi-deficiency,yang heat and yang qi to calculate differentiation of symptoms and signs. Results The different velocity of increase about the tumor-bearing mice in the early phase is great.With the development of pathogenic condition,the incidence and degree about different deficiency is increasing. Among it,qi deficiency is the most severest,next is deficiency of yang-qi and the incidence of yin deficiency is low. With the development of pathogenic condition,the ratio of asthenia syndrome and accompanying symptoms and signs of tumor-bearing mice increase,the number of no-syndrome and mono-syndrome decrease and compound syndrome group increase greatly.The prognosis is bad with earlier tumor growth rapidly,correlation analysis has statistical significance(P = 0.01).The prognosis is fairly bad about deficiency of yang-qi,qi deficiency and yang heat. In the course of disease,armpit temperature decreased,weight stability and decrease is the important mark of bad prognosis.The research shows that it is important to control earlier tumor increase,the emphasis of therapy should be in tumor part and do not harm body healthy energy and supporting yang-qi is essential.According to the therapeutic effect of tumor,we requested that after tumor appeared,randomization should be based on tumor size in order to avoid its bias and affect therapeutic evaluation. Conclusion During the collection of symptoms about disease mice in this study,we first adopt standard four diagnostic methods detection technology and this technology is quantified,methods we build conduce to reveal morbid state about abiogenesis and succession of symptoms.It provides technology to syndrome differentiation,treatment and basic investigation,which has important academic and application value.
